Scott) Distribution: news Organization: Wetware Diversions, San Francisco Lines: 7 In article <294@nixsin.UUCP> koerberm@nixsin.UUCP (Mathias Koerber) writes: > use the "s" command >to save the article to a file. You will be asked if rn shall save the >article in mailbox format, which you should answer with "n". If you find that question annoying, put -N in the RNINIT environment variable (or file it points to).
